Hospice is a specialty you move into. Med surg, oncology, or home health is the usual door in.

Worth asking

The posting doesn’t answer these. Good ones to ask a recruiter or in the interview.

  • Can you walk me through base pay range, differentials, and sign-on bonus repayment terms?
  • What should I expect for holiday and rotation?
  • What orientation, preceptor time, and ongoing unit support are included?
  • How are floating and staffing support handled day to day?
